The invention provides a host material for organic light emitting diodes, having the general formula:
wherein R
1
is selected from a C
1-8
alkyl group, each R
2
is independently selected from a hydrogen or a C
1-8
alkyl group, Ar is selected from a C
5-14
aromatic or hetero aromatic group, R
3
is selected from a C
5-14
aromatic or hetero aromatic group, a C
1-8
alkyl group, a C
5-8
cycloalkyl group, a C
1-8
fluoroalkyl group, or a C
1-8
alkoxyl group, and n is an integer of 1-10. The host materials have a higher energy gap (greater than 4.0 eV), and high thermal stability.
